Do not know if the director was running out of ideas, but this song appears to be a duplicate in some ways. The film is Baadhsah from 1964. Two songs from this film are already posted. With reference to the song “Ae Jee Mein Ne Kahaa Suniye To Zaraa” – when I compare these two songs, they seem to be very similar in intent and also in terms of the players on whom this is picturized. The earlier posted song is also performed on screen by this actress, Kumari Rani, trying to stop and annoyed looking Dara Singh from leaving her company. The scenario is repeated in this song also. Once again, the song is performed by Kumari Rani. Dara Singh is playing the offended gentleman, and the lady love is trying to stop him from leaving. In this case, the one additional characteristic stands out – apparently the lady knows some kind of magic, for she disappears and reappears a few times during the performance of this song.
